A line passes through the points (1, 3) and (3, -1) on a coordinate plane. What is the equation of this line in slope-intercept

form?
y = [ ] x [ ] [ ]


fill in the [ ].
Mathematics
2 answers:
FromTheMoon [43]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

y=[-2]x[+][5]

Step-by-step explanation:

\frac{-1-3}{3-1}=\frac{-4}{2} =-2 m= -2

Using the point (1,3) Find the value of b

3= -2(1)+b

3= -2+b

+2  +2

---------

5=b

y= -2x+5

Help find the surface area
zhenek [66]
Surface area is the sum of the areas of all faces (or surfaces) on a 3D shape. A cuboid has 6 rectangular faces. To find the surface area of a cuboid, add the areas of all 6 faces. We can also label the length (l), width (w), and height (h) of the prism and use the formula, SA=2lw+2lh+2hw, to find the surface area.
